Jadavpur University Bags Complete Academic Autonomy; To Get Rs. 50-100 Crore Grant

Jadavpur University (JU) has been granted complete academic autonomy and has been featured in the list of 52 universities or institutes that were granted greater autonomy and moderate to greater autonomy . Satisfied with the performance of JU, the Union Cabinet has approved a grant of Rs. 100 crore each to ten universities that have scored 3.5 or above in NAAC assessment . Similarly, 20 stat e-level universities that have been awarded autonomy will get Rs. 50 crore. JU is expected to get over Rs. 50 crores to Rs. 100 crore from the central government .

Vice Chancellor of JU, Mr. Suranjan Das thanked MHRD for the surprising announcement. The grant of funds will regulate misapprehensions about the innovative courses that must be offered in self-financing mode. The grant will help the varsity to utilise the newly accorded status and to attain greater heights of academic excellence. However, it would be better if both state and central universities in Category I provided with a uniform amount of financial assistance , he opined.

Adding further, the VC of JU explained that the financial grant would be utilised for developing high-quality infrastructure , provide assistance to teachers, students and scholars, launch interdisciplinary socially relevant teaching and learning courses and develop international academic networks . However, the decision regarding utilisation of funds must be taken by the varsity community and not by the administration, he concluded.

As per MHRD, the universities in the elite category will be allocated funds for improving the overall quality of higher education.
